The automotive sector is a major contributor to the growth of the CFRP (Carbon Fiber Reinforced Polymer) recycling market in Germany. As the demand for lightweight and high-strength materials increases, automotive manufacturers are focusing on integrating CFRP into vehicle design to enhance performance and fuel efficiency. The recycling of CFRP materials within this sector helps reduce manufacturing costs and environmental impact by enabling the reuse of valuable carbon fibers. Advanced recycling technologies, such as mechanical grinding and pyrolysis, are being adopted to reclaim and repurpose CFRP waste from automotive production processes and end-of-life vehicles. This approach not only supports the sustainability goals of the automotive industry but also aligns with regulatory pressures for reduced carbon footprints and improved resource efficiency.
In the aerospace industry, the recycling of CFRP materials is crucial due to the sector's emphasis on reducing weight while maintaining structural integrity. CFRP's high strength-to-weight ratio makes it an ideal material for aerospace applications, but its disposal presents environmental challenges. Recycling processes are being optimized to handle CFRP waste generated from aircraft production and maintenance activities. Techniques such as chemical recycling and solvent-based methods are being developed to efficiently recover carbon fibers from CFRP composites used in aerospace components. By recycling CFRP, the aerospace industry can mitigate waste management issues, reduce costs associated with raw material procurement, and contribute to broader sustainability initiatives within the sector.
The sporting goods sector is increasingly utilizing CFRP due to its excellent strength and lightweight properties, which enhance performance in sports equipment. As the popularity of CFRP-based sporting goods grows, so does the need for effective recycling solutions to manage end-of-life products. The recycling of CFRP in this sector focuses on recovering valuable carbon fibers from items such as bicycles, golf clubs, and tennis rackets. Technologies like thermoplastic recycling and fiber reclamation are being explored to handle the composite waste generated from the production and disposal of sporting goods. Implementing recycling processes in this market segment helps reduce material costs, promote circular economy practices, and minimize the environmental impact associated with CFRP disposal.

What is CFRP?
CFRP stands for Carbon Fiber Reinforced Polymer, which is a high-strength, lightweight composite material used in various industries such as aerospace, automotive, and construction.
What is the CFRP recycle market?
The CFRP recycle market refers to the industry involved in the recycling and reusing of carbon fiber reinforced polymer materials to reduce waste and environmental impact.

What are the types of CFRP recycling technologies?
CFRP recycling technologies include mechanical recycling, pyrolysis, and solvolysis, each of which has its own advantages and limitations.
